Phytochemical investigation of leaves of Datura stramonium

Abstract
Datura stramonium widely spread all over the world, increasing under a wide range of climatic conditions and has been used as a medicinal herb in traditional Ayurvedic medicine as antipyretic agents, also or the treatment of inflammation, ulcer, diabetic, asthma. The aim of the study was designed to evaluate the chemical composition of different fractions found from Datura stramonium. Phytochemistry activity of Datura stramonium (Green leaf) were undertaken with standard methods. The leaf sample after being screening for phytochemicals, contained tannins, saponins, flavonoids, alkaloids, steroids, phenolic compounds, proteins at different concentration and seed contain excessive number of proteins and carbohydrates along with the secondary metabolites.
